				Flying with the Cybook
			 
			
			When my children were toddlers, I discovered a wonderful stlye of pocketbook with a side compartment just the perfect size to hold a diaper & a plastic bag with wipes. When the diapers were no longer needed, the space was quickly filled with a book that fit perfectly in the compartment.  That space now holds my CyBook - a perfect fit!   I carried my brand new Cybook in its own pocket in my pocketbook on to a plane (that flys) and stored it under my seat when I ate the "snack" provided. The only problem I experienced occurred because I sat in the middle seat with a fixed light that beamed directly on to the screen causing a stong glare. I had to hold the Cybook at an angle in order to see the screen. I resolved that by placing my all purpose pocketbook on the pull-down tray and using it as a brace for the Cybook to lean against. I truly enjoyed four hours of nearly uninterrupted reading while flying. Note: The attendants at the airport security checkpoints both ways wanted to send the Cybook through the X-ray machine. When I insisted on hand inspections, they actually weighed it on their little scales! |
